Wrestling: Hart MEC Champion as Seven Wildcats Qualify for NCWA Nationals

 

 

WILLIAMSPORT, Pa. – The Pennsylvania College of Technology hosted the Mid-East Conference Championships Saturday with 15 teams and 91 wrestlers in attendance. Freshman Ryan Hart (Wyalusing) won the 133 class and sophomore Logan Gresock (Wadsworth, Ohio) was runner up in 174. The Wildcats placed third as a team behind champion University of Maryland – Baltimore County and second place Penn State DuBois. The tournament is also a qualifier for the National Collegiate Wrestling Association Championships. In addition to Hart and Gresock making the cut, junior Tyler Myers (Centre Hall), sophomores Austin Clark (Elysburg) and Paul Crutchlow and freshmen Daniel Frankenfield (Dushore) and Alexander Muller (Sparta, N.J.) all earned berths.

 

Myers placed third at 157 taking down fellow conference rival Shane Alterio. Crutchlow also came in third at 184 and teammate Muller was sixth in the same class. Rounding out the place finishers were Clark in fourth at 165 and Frankenfield in fifth at 174.

 

The Wildcats will have a little less than two weeks to prep for the March 14th championships held this year in Allen, Texas.
